We are seeking a detail-oriented and proactive Compliance Analyst to support the compliance function in ensuring adherence to all regulatory and anti-financial crime requirements.
In this role, the successful candidate will assist with the monitoring and implementation of compliance policies and procedures, support the Compliance Monitoring Programme, and help ensure company-wide understanding of key regulations. They will also contribute to anti-financial crime efforts by assisting with due diligence reviews, sanctions screening, and suspicious activity investigations.
Responsibilities include preparing reports for internal and external stakeholders, maintaining compliance registers, and supporting audits and staff training. This is an excellent opportunity for someone with at least two years of experience in a compliance role and a solid understanding of local regulations and fiduciary obligations. Strong communication, discretion, and organisational skills are essential.
